GM, Vale Clinch Canada Nickel Supply Deal for EV Batteries

November 23, 2022--Researched by Industrial Info Resources (Sugar Land, Texas)--General Motors Company (NYSE:GM) (GM) (Detroit, Michigan) and a Canadian subsidiary of Brazilian mining giant Vale (NYSE:VALE) (Rio de Janeiro) have reached an agreement for the long-term supply of battery-grade nickel sulfate from Vale's planned plant at Becancour, Quebec, to support GM's production of electric vehicles (EVs) in North America, the companies said last week.
